What is a hospitality design intern?

Hospitality Design Interns are students or recent graduates who assist professional designers in creating functional and visually appealing spaces for hotels, resorts, restaurants, and other hospitality environments. They typically support the design team with tasks such as drafting layouts, selecting materials, researching trends, and preparing presentations. These internships provide valuable hands-on experience, help interns build a portfolio, and offer insight into how hospitality spaces are conceptualized and developed.

What types of projects and responsibilities can I expect as a hospitality design intern?

As a Hospitality Design Intern, you will typically assist with various aspects of the design process for hotels, restaurants, and other hospitality spaces. Your daily tasks may include preparing presentation boards, assisting with CAD drawings, selecting materials and finishes, and supporting senior designers during client meetings. You'll often collaborate closely with architects, project managers, and vendors to ensure design concepts align with client expectations. This role provides valuable exposure to real-world projects and can be a stepping stone toward more advanced positions in interior or hospitality design.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a hospitality design intern,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Hospitality Design Intern, you need a solid understanding of design principles, proficiency in drafting and rendering, and typically a background in interior design or architecture. Familiarity with industry-standard software such as AutoCAD, SketchUp, and Adobe Creative Suite is essential, and knowledge of LEED or other sustainability certifications is advantageous. Strong teamwork, communication, and attention to detail help you collaborate effectively and contribute creative ideas within project teams. These skills ensure you can support complex design projects, meet client expectations, and develop professionally in the dynamic hospitality industry.

What is the difference between Hospitality Design Intern vs Interior Design Intern?

AspectHospitality Design InternInterior Design Intern
Required CredentialsEnrolled in or recent graduate of architecture, interior design, or related fieldEnrolled in or recent graduate of interior design, architecture, or related program
Work EnvironmentHotels, resorts, restaurants, and hospitality venuesResidential, commercial, or institutional spaces
Employer & Industry UsageDesign firms specializing in hospitality projectsDesign firms, architecture firms, or independent practices
Common Search & Comparison IntentYesYes

Hospitality Design Interns focus on creating spaces for hotels, resorts, and restaurants, often working within specialized hospitality design firms. Interior Design Interns have a broader scope, working on residential, commercial, or institutional interiors. While both roles require similar educational backgrounds and skills, Hospitality Design Interns typically concentrate on hospitality-specific projects, making the comparison relevant for those exploring careers in hospitality-focused design.

About Construction Management - AECOM Hunt

Founded in 1944 in Indianapolis, Indiana, AECOM Hunt has been building for over 80 years. AECOM Hunt's storied history has encompassed many notable projects in over a dozen industries; iconic sports stadiums; an impressive portfolio in aviation; and many repeat clients in the hospitality and convention center industry. From iconic stadiums and arenas, next-gen transportation hubs and sustainable healthcare and academic buildings, AECOM Hunt's expertise, leadership and dedication are unparalleled.
